Caprese Chicken

Easy Caprese Chicken

  • Author: Adeline Parker
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 25 minutes
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Category: Main Course
  • Method: Oven
  • Cuisine: Italian
  • Diet: Gluten Free

Description

Easy Caprese Chicken is a simple oven-baked dish featuring tender chicken breasts coated in a balsamic-tomato mixture, topped with melted mozzarella cheese and fresh basil for a fresh Italian-inspired flavor.


Ingredients

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 2 pounds total)
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 pint grape or cherry tomatoes
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ons balsamic glaze, plus more for serving
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ons kosher salt, divided
  • 1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
  • 4 ounces fresh mozzarella cheese, thinly sliced
  • 1/4 small bunch fresh basil, leaves picked and thinly sliced (about 2 tablespoons)


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
  2. In a broiler-safe 9×13-inch baking dish, combine the minced garlic, grape or cherry tomatoes, olive oil, 2 tablespoons balsamic glaze, and 1/2 teaspoon of kosher salt. Stir to combine thoroughly.
  3. Prepare the chicken breasts: working one at a time, place each breast in a large resealable bag and pound to an even 1/2-inch thickness. Season all over with the remaining 1 teaspoon kosher salt and 1/4 teaspoon black pepper.
  4. Add the seasoned chicken breasts to the baking dish, turning them to coat completely with the balsamic-tomato mixture. Arrange the chicken and tomatoes in an even layer.
  5. Roast for 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and registers at least 165 degrees F (74 degrees C) with an instant-read thermometer inserted into the thickest part.
  6. Once the chicken is cooked, remove the dish from the oven. Arrange the thinly sliced fresh mozzarella cheese over the chicken and tomatoes.
  7. Switch your oven to broiler setting. Broil for 1-2 minutes, watching carefully, until the mozzarella is melted and lightly bubbly.
  8. Remove from the oven, drizzle with additional balsamic glaze if desired, and garnish with the fresh basil. Serve immediately.

Notes

  • Watch the dish closely under the broiler to prevent the cheese from burning.
  • Use an instant-read thermometer to ensure the chicken reaches a safe internal temperature of 165°F.
  • This recipe is best served fresh, but le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
